400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

plc如何定义

作者:路由通
|
207人看过
发布时间:2026-02-12 07:32:31
标签:
可编程逻辑控制器(PLC)是一种专门为工业环境设计的数字运算电子系统。它通过可编程存储器,执行逻辑运算、顺序控制、定时、计数和算术操作等指令,控制各类机械或生产过程。其核心在于用“可编程”的软件逻辑替代传统继电器控制的硬接线,实现了工业自动化控制的灵活性与可靠性革命。本文将从其本质、历史演进、核心构成、工作原理及在现代工业中的角色等多个维度,为您深入剖析PLC的定义与内涵。
plc如何定义

       在现代化工厂的车间里,机器手臂精准地挥舞,流水线有条不紊地运转,这一切高效协同的背后,往往站着一个沉默的“指挥官”——可编程逻辑控制器(Programmable Logic Controller, 简称PLC)。对于许多初入工业自动化领域的朋友而言,PLC这个名词既熟悉又陌生。熟悉,是因为它无处不在;陌生,则在于其内部究竟如何运作,其定义又包含了哪些深刻的层次。今天,我们就拨开技术的迷雾,深入探讨“PLC如何定义”这一根本问题。

       一、 追根溯源:从“继电器的继承者”到“工业计算机”

       要理解一个事物,最好的方式是从它的诞生开始。上世纪六十年代末,美国汽车制造业面临巨大挑战。每当车型更新换代,生产线上由成千上万继电器、计时器和专用接线构成的庞大控制系统就必须进行大规模物理重构,耗时耗力,成本高昂,严重制约了生产效率。行业急需一种能够通过“编程”而非“重新接线”来改变控制逻辑的装置。

       1968年,美国通用汽车公司(General Motors)发布了著名的“十条招标规范”,这被视为PLC诞生的直接催化剂。这份规范要求一种新型控制器,它必须易于编程和维护,能在恶劣工业环境下可靠工作,并且体积要小于传统的继电器控制柜。基于这一需求,次年,美国数字设备公司(Digital Equipment Corporation)的工程师迪克·莫利成功研制出世界上第一台可编程逻辑控制器,型号为PDP-14。它的出现,标志着工业控制从依赖硬件的固定逻辑,迈向了依靠软件的可变逻辑时代。

       因此,PLC最初的定义非常直接:它是为了替代继电器控制系统而发明的一种可编程的、固态的工业控制装置。随着微处理器技术的飞速发展,PLC的功能早已超越了简单的逻辑控制,集成了数据处理、模拟量调节、运动控制、网络通信等强大能力,其定义也随之演变为:一种专为工业环境设计,基于微处理器,通过可编程存储器来存储和执行用户指令,实现对机械设备或生产流程进行自动化控制的数字运算电子系统。从这个角度看,PLC已从单纯的“继电器替代品”成长为功能强大的“专用工业计算机”。

       二、 核心特质:构成定义的四大基石

       一个清晰的定义离不开对其核心特质的把握。PLC的定义建立在以下几个无可辩驳的基石之上:

       第一,可编程性。这是PLC区别于传统硬接线控制系统的根本属性。用户(通常是工程师)可以根据控制需求,使用专用的编程语言(如梯形图、指令表、功能块图等)编写控制程序,并将其下载到PLC的存储器中。当需要改变控制逻辑或工艺流程时,无需改动任何物理接线,只需修改程序并重新下载即可。这种灵活性是自动化系统能够快速响应市场变化的关键。

       第二,工业级可靠性。PLC的设计目标就是应对工厂车间里常见的灰尘、油污、电磁干扰、振动、温度波动等恶劣条件。其元器件经过严格筛选,采用模块化、密封性好的结构设计,平均无故障工作时间极长。许多高端PLC甚至能在零下几十度到零上七八十度的宽温范围内稳定运行。这种与生俱来的“强壮体魄”,是普通计算机或单片机系统难以比拟的,也是其定义中“专为工业环境设计”的具体体现。

       第三,实时性与确定性。工业控制对响应时间有严格要求。PLC采用周期扫描的工作方式,其运行周期(从读取输入、执行程序到更新输出)是稳定且可预测的。无论程序多么复杂,系统都能保证在一个扫描周期内完成所有任务,这种确定性响应对于确保机械动作精准同步、防止安全事故至关重要。

       第四,接口的友好性与丰富性。PLC面向的是广大电气工程师和技术人员,因此其输入输出(I/O)接口设计得非常直观,能够直接连接按钮、传感器(开关量)、变送器(模拟量)以及接触器、电磁阀等现场设备。同时,现代PLC也集成了丰富的通信接口,如以太网、现场总线等,使其能够轻松融入更上层的监控系统与企业信息网络。

       三、 解剖结构:硬件与软件的定义性融合

       从物理构成上定义PLC,它是一套由硬件和软件紧密结合的系统。硬件是躯体,软件是灵魂。

       硬件方面,核心是中央处理单元(CPU),它如同PLC的大脑,负责执行用户程序、协调系统各部分工作。存储器则分为系统存储器(存放监控程序)和用户存储器(存放用户编写的控制程序和数据)。输入输出单元是PLC与外部世界沟通的桥梁,负责将现场设备的信号转换为CPU可以处理的数字信号,以及将CPU的处理结果转换为能驱动执行机构的信号。电源单元为整个系统提供稳定、隔离的直流工作电源。此外,根据需求,还可以扩展各种特殊功能模块,如模拟量输入输出模块、高速计数模块、运动控制模块、通信模块等。

       软件方面,主要包括系统软件和用户程序。系统软件固化在CPU中,管理着PLC的自身运行,如扫描周期的控制、自诊断、通信管理等。用户程序则是定义PLC具体行为的“剧本”,由工程师使用编程软件编写。国际电工委员会(IEC)在其61131-3标准中定义了五种PLC编程语言:梯形图(LD)、指令表(IL)、功能块图(FBD)、顺序功能图(SFC)和结构化文本(ST)。其中,梯形图因其形象直观,与继电器电路图相似,成为了最广泛使用的语言,这也从侧面印证了PLC与继电器控制系统之间的历史传承关系。

       四、 运作机理:扫描周期揭示的动态定义

       理解PLC的定义,不能停留在静态结构,必须洞察其动态的工作过程,即著名的“扫描周期”。这是一个周而复始的循环过程,每个周期通常包含三个阶段:

       第一阶段是输入采样。PLC以极快的速度一次性读取所有输入端子上的状态(通或断,高电平或低电平),并将这些状态存入“输入映像寄存器”。在此阶段,无论外部输入信号如何变化,映像寄存器中的状态保持不变,这保证了在一个扫描周期内,程序处理依据的是同一批“快照”数据,增强了系统的稳定性。

       第二阶段是程序执行。CPU按照用户程序指令的顺序(通常是从上到下,从左到右),逐条解读并执行逻辑运算。执行过程中,所有需要的输入状态均从输入映像寄存器中读取,所有产生的逻辑结果都暂存于“输出映像寄存器”和内部辅助继电器中。此时,真实的物理输出端子状态并未改变。

       第三阶段是输出刷新。当用户程序全部执行完毕后,CPU将输出映像寄存器中的状态,一次性传送到物理输出锁存电路,驱动外部负载(如指示灯亮起、电机启动)。完成输出刷新后,PLC自动进入下一个扫描周期,重复上述过程。

       这种“集中输入、集中输出”的扫描工作方式,是PLC实现确定性和可靠性的核心机制,也是其定义中“数字运算电子系统”运行逻辑的具体化。

       五、 能力边界:定义在功能扩展中不断拓宽

       早期的PLC,正如其名,主要专注于逻辑控制。但技术的进步不断拓宽其能力边界,也使得其定义的内涵日益丰富。

       如今,主流PLC已普遍具备模拟量处理能力,能够接收温度、压力、流量等连续变化的信号,并进行比例积分微分(PID)调节,实现过程的闭环控制。在运动控制领域,通过专用模块或高速脉冲输出,PLC可以精确控制伺服电机和步进电机,完成定位、同步、插补等复杂动作。网络通信能力更是成为现代PLC的标配,从设备层的现场总线到工厂级的工业以太网,PLC作为网络节点,实现了与远程I/O站、人机界面(HMI)、其他PLC以及上位管理计算机的数据交换,构成了分布式控制系统(DCS)的坚实基础。

       此外,数据处理、文件管理、甚至边缘计算等高级功能也逐步集成。因此,当今对PLC的定义,必须包含其作为“多功能工业自动化控制核心”的角色。

       六、 标准视角:国际权威机构的规范性定义

       为了规范行业发展,国际电工委员会(International Electrotechnical Commission)和中国国家标准都对PLC给出了官方定义。例如,中国国家标准GB/T 15969.1-2007《可编程序控制器 第1部分:通用信息》中,将可编程序控制器定义为:一种用于工业环境的数字式电子系统。这种系统用可编程的存储器作面向用户指令的内部寄存器,完成规定的功能,如逻辑、顺序、定时、计数、运算等,并通过数字或模拟的输入输出,控制各种类型的机械或过程。

       这一定义高度凝练,涵盖了PLC的适用环境(工业环境)、本质(数字式电子系统)、核心特征(可编程存储器、用户指令)、基本功能(逻辑、顺序、定时等)以及最终目的(控制机械或过程)。它是我们从技术标准和行业规范层面理解PLC定义的权威依据。

       七、 横向对比:在与相关概念的区分中明晰定义

       要更清晰地界定PLC,不妨将其与几个容易混淆的概念进行对比。

       首先是单片机。单片机是一种集成到单一芯片上的微型计算机系统,功能通用,但本身并非为直接应对工业恶劣环境而设计,其可靠性、抗干扰能力以及I/O接口的驱动和保护通常需要额外电路来实现。PLC则可以看作是基于单片机或微处理器技术,经过二次深度开发、封装和强化,专用于控制领域的“成品”系统,强调开箱即用和工程化的易用性。

       其次是工业个人计算机(IPC)。IPC基于通用的计算机架构,运行Windows或Linux等操作系统,擅长处理大量数据、复杂算法和图形界面。但其在实时性、确定性和环境适应性上通常不如PLC。在实际应用中,两者常协同工作,IPC担任上位监控和管理角色,而PLC负责下层实时、可靠的具体控制。

       最后是分布式控制系统(DCS)。传统上,DCS更侧重于流程工业(如化工、电力)的模拟量连续过程控制,系统架构庞大且封闭。而PLC起源于离散制造业(如汽车、机床)的顺序逻辑控制。但随着技术融合,两者界限已非常模糊。现代大型PLC系统在网络化和过程控制功能上已非常强大,而DCS也广泛采纳了PLC作为其现场控制站。可以说,PLC是构建现代自动化系统,无论是离散控制、过程控制还是混合控制,最通用、最基础的单元。

       八、 应用场景:定义在千行百业中的生动体现

       PLC的定义并非空中楼阁,它生动地体现在每一个应用场景中。在汽车制造厂,它控制着焊接机器人的轨迹和喷涂机械臂的启停;在食品饮料生产线,它管理着灌装、封盖、贴标、包装的全流程节奏;在楼宇中,它实现着照明、空调、电梯的自动管理;在轨道交通领域,它监控着车站设备的运行;甚至在现代化的农业大棚和污水处理厂,也能见到PLC默默工作的身影。

       这些纷繁的应用共同描绘出PLC定义的实践轮廓:它是将抽象的自动控制思想,转化为具体、可靠、高效生产力的关键使能技术。

       九、 发展趋势:定义面向未来的演进方向

       随着工业4.0、智能制造和物联网浪潮的推进,PLC的定义仍在持续演进。小型化、高性能化是永恒的主题,未来的PLC将更小巧,但计算能力更强。集成化程度更高,将更多运动控制、视觉识别、安全功能集成于一体。开放性与互联性至关重要,支持开放标准协议(如OPC UA),实现与云端平台、大数据系统的无缝对接。此外,编程的简易化与高级化并存,在保留传统梯形图等直观语言的同时,也支持更高级的计算机语言,以应对复杂算法和人工智能应用的集成。

       可以说,未来的PLC,其定义将更倾向于“智能工业边缘控制器”,在工厂网络的边缘侧,不仅完成实时控制,还承担起数据采集、边缘计算、智能决策等更丰富的职责。

       十、 总结:一个多层次、动态发展的综合性定义

       综上所述,“PLC如何定义”并非一个简单的名词解释,而是一个包含历史维度、技术内核、结构组成、工作机理、功能范围、标准规范、对比差异和实践演进的综合性课题。它既是一台为替代继电器而生的坚固设备,也是一台专用于控制的工业计算机;既是一套由硬件和软件构成的系统,也是一个遵循扫描周期运行的实时引擎;既受国际标准的严谨界定,又在千行百业中展现灵活身姿;既承载着过去五十多年的技术积淀,又面向智能制造的未来不断进化。

       因此,我们可以这样概括PLC的定义:它是一种植根于工业需求,以可编程性为核心,以超高可靠性和实时确定性为生命,通过周期扫描方式运行,集逻辑控制、过程调节、运动控制与数据通信于一体,并持续向智能化、网络化、集成化发展的工业自动化核心控制装置。理解这一定义,不仅是掌握一项技术,更是理解现代工业自动化思想精髓的一把钥匙。

       希望这篇深入的分析,能帮助您真正建立起对可编程逻辑控制器清晰、立体而深刻的认识。当您再次走进车间,听到设备规律的轰鸣声时,或许能感受到,那正是无数个PLC,以其严格定义的方式,在精准地谱写着一曲工业自动化的交响乐章。

相关文章
excel为什么老是显示未响应
当电子表格软件频繁陷入“未响应”的僵局时,背后往往是多种因素交织的结果。本文将从软件冲突、文件过载、系统资源、加载项干扰、公式与链接、版本兼容性、硬件驱动、病毒防护、用户操作习惯、软件故障、操作系统环境以及后台进程等十二个核心维度,进行深度剖析与排查。我们将提供一系列经过验证的实用解决方案,旨在帮助您从根本上诊断问题,恢复软件流畅运行,并建立长效的预防机制,让数据处理工作重回高效轨道。
2026-02-12 07:31:41
80人看过
word中减法用什么公式表示
本文深入探讨在微软Word文档中执行减法运算的多种公式表示方法与实用技巧。文章将从基础的单元格引用减法开始,逐步解析表格计算、字段代码应用以及公式编辑器的进阶功能。内容涵盖自动求和工具、书签变量运算、列表编号减法等十二个核心应用场景,并结合官方功能指南,提供详尽的步骤解析与避坑指南,旨在帮助用户全方位掌握在Word中进行数值减法的专业技能。
2026-02-12 07:31:36
83人看过
为什么word转出pdf提示错误
在日常办公与文档处理中,许多用户都曾遭遇过将微软Word文档转换为可移植文档格式时系统报错的困扰。这一过程看似简单,却可能因文档内容复杂性、软件设置冲突、系统环境异常乃至文件自身损坏等多种潜在因素而中断。本文将系统性地剖析导致转换失败的十二个核心原因,从字体嵌入、图像兼容性到软件权限与更新问题,并提供一系列经过验证的实用解决方案,旨在帮助用户彻底排查并修复此类问题,确保文档转换流程的顺畅无阻。
2026-02-12 07:31:26
341人看过
word文档为什么自动显示水印
在日常使用文字处理软件时,许多用户都遇到过文档突然自动显示水印的困扰,这不仅影响文档的美观,也可能涉及文档的权限与安全设置。本文将深入剖析这一现象背后的十二个核心原因,从软件的基础功能设置、模板应用,到文档的共享协作与高级安全特性,进行系统性解读。文章旨在提供清晰的问题诊断路径与实用的解决方案,帮助用户彻底理解并掌控文档中的水印显示逻辑,提升办公效率与文档管理能力。
2026-02-12 07:31:25
128人看过
word中为什么图片移不动
在使用文档处理软件时,许多用户会遇到一个令人困惑的问题:图片似乎被固定在某个位置,无法自由拖动。这一现象通常并非软件缺陷,而是由于软件本身的排版机制、图片的环绕方式设置、文档格式限制或操作技巧等多种因素共同导致。本文将深入剖析图片无法移动的十二个核心原因,并提供一系列经过验证的解决方案,帮助您彻底掌握文档中图片布局的控制权,提升文档编辑效率。
2026-02-12 07:31:15
238人看过
转接卡是什么
转接卡是一种用于连接不同接口或协议的硬件设备,它允许用户将一种类型的硬件接口转换为另一种,从而扩展设备的兼容性和功能。常见于计算机硬件领域,如将旧式显卡接口转换为新式插槽,或在存储设备中连接不同标准的硬盘。转接卡的应用广泛,能有效提升硬件利用率,降低升级成本,并解决新旧技术之间的衔接问题。本文将从定义、类型、工作原理、应用场景及选购要点等方面,详细解析转接卡的核心知识。
2026-02-12 07:30:50
305人看过